The team
The Product Architect role is part of the Product Group and plays a critical role in shaping the overall architecture and service design of the group’s offerings. This includes developing and maintaining the technical product roadmap, ensuring architectural decisions and technical designs align with enterprise-wide strategies, standards and integration patterns. The role also involves providing quality assurance and governance over key architectural deliverables, such as systems engineering documents, to maintain consistency and technical integrity. You will work closely with engineering, security and platform teams to drive innovation while ensuring robust, scalable and compliant solutions.
What will you be doing?
Shaping product roadmaps, including defining scope, prioritization and delivery timelines, while addressing solution design and technical debt
Producing technology and service architecture solutions aligned with enterprise product strategies and ensuring they pass through Design Authorities, considering capacity, ITSCM, data governance, security and licensing
Reviewing and quality assuring artefacts from external suppliers and internal teams, ensuring alignment with business and non-functional requirements
Identifying opportunities for product innovation, shaping design proposals and driving business benefits aligned with the product roadmap
Supporting integration and functional testing to ensure business acceptance criteria and risk management, including security, licensing and capacity risks
Leading and mentoring within communities of practice, providing thought leadership and building architectural capabilities across the organisation
